Juren (simplified Chinese: 举人; traditional Chinese: 舉人; pinyin: jǔrén) was a rank achieved by people who passed the national exam in the imperial examination system of Imperial China.[1] It was higher than the shengyuan, but lower than jinshi, the highest degree.
